Rebel Wolves recently held a gameplay presentation of The Blood of Dawnwalker, an upcoming ambitious RPG, the development of which is led by the key authors of The Witcher 3: Wild Hunt.
In a twenty-minute gameplay video, the authors showed several key gameplay sequences of The Blood of Dawnwalker, which are divided into night and day. During the day, Cohen (that’s the name of the protagonist) must deal with tasks in human form, and at night, he grows claws and acquires vampire superpowers. The authors call their project a narrative sandbox: it will have several main storylines at once, and only the player is free to decide which one he wants to follow. At the same time, the passage is limited to a time period of 30 game days, and the time of day does not move in real time, but as the tasks are completed.
Thus, the task of visiting the Swartrow Cathedral in the demonstration was completed in two different ways: the presenter went there at different times of the day and saw different pictures. During the day, a baby was being baptized in the cathedral, and it was impossible to visit its distant corners without vampire skills. At night, evil spirits were conducting some kind of bloody ritual in the cathedral, and supernatural skills allowed the hero not to use the main passage – he climbed into the building from above, with vampire dashes through space. The authors assure that the development of new stages of the tasks will depend on the decisions made in the previous time of day.
The character’s appearance also affects the combat system: during the day, he will have to deal with enemies with a sword and dark magic, and at night – tear them apart with claws and vampire skills. Of course, in the form of a bloodsucker, you need to satisfy your brutal appetite, otherwise the level of hunger will reduce the character’s health. For fans of pacifist walkthroughs, there is an option not to kill your victims, or even feed on animal blood. The vampire and the human will have their own leveling trees.
The Blood of Dawnwalker is expected to be released in 2026, with no exact release date yet. It is known that the project will not receive an official translation into Russian.
